About the role

Would you like to support safe and sustainable development in Leeds? We have an exciting opportunity in the Transport Development Services Team, within the Highways and Transportation Service of Leeds City Council. You would be involved in assessing a wide variety of development proposals and promoting safe and sustainable transport options and opportunities for developments. You should have an HNC (level 4) or HND (level 5) qualification in Civil Engineering or an equivalent level qualification relevant to transport planning / civil engineering and/or experience relevant to the post.

The post is full time (37 hours a week) with flexible/hybrid working, based at Merrion House in Leeds City Centre.

Job description and qualifications

Job Purpose: To assess the impact on the transport network of development proposals and to identify and promote potential solutions.

Responsibilities for Grade:

* Assess transport impact of development proposals, giving advice to developers and negotiating the provision of appropriate solutions.
* Evaluate existing and proposed scenarios to identify transport-related problems and solutions using traffic models and other analytical tools where appropriate.
* Liaise with other Council directorates and outside agencies.
* Respond to consultations and requests for advice on planning applications and other related issues.
* Carry out site visits anywhere within the authority’s borders.
* Assist in developing work programmes.
* Monitor own progress against targets.
* Prepare and present reports including requests for decisions by Elected Members and delegated officers.
* Prepare and present evidence for hearings and written representation planning appeals.
* Assist in preparing evidence for public inquiries.
* Assist as required in the co-ordination of services to one or more Community Committees to ensure effective and responsive communication and reporting on issues of concern.
* Deputise as required for Senior Highways Development Engineers.
* Follow procedures and maintain records in accordance with the directorate’s standards.
* Maintain a knowledge and awareness of new developments related to the area of work.
